Understanding the Core Functionality
The primary function of a Home Depot fan light is to integrate a ceiling fan with a light fixture. This combination optimizes space and reduces the need for multiple separate fixtures in a room. The fan component helps move air throughout a space, creating a wind-chill effect that makes a room feel cooler without actually lowering the thermostat. This circulation can lead to reduced energy costs during warmer months. The light fixture offers efficient illumination, often using energy-saving LED bulbs, which provide bright, clear light for various activities. The ability to operate the fan and light independently or together allows for customized comfort and ambiance.
Key Components and Operation
Inside a typical Home Depot fan light, several key components work together seamlessly. The motor is the heart of the device, driving the rotation of the blades. Blade pitch and design are critical factors in determining the fan's efficiency and its ability to move air effectively. Modern units often feature whisper-quiet motors, ensuring the fan operates without becoming a distracting noise source. The lighting component usually consists of a central fixture powered by the fan's motor or a separate circuit, providing ample light for the area. Wall controls or remote options allow users to adjust speed, direction, and lighting with ease.

Matching Size to Space
Selecting the correct size fan for the room is crucial for optimal performance and visual balance. A fan that is too small will not move enough air to be effective, while an oversized fan can overwhelm a small space. As a general guideline, rooms up to 75 square feet are suitable for fans with a 29- to 36-inch span. For spaces between 75 and 144 square feet, a 36- to 42-inch fan is ideal. Larger rooms, such as greats or open-plan areas, benefit from fans with a 52-inch span or even hugger models designed for low ceilings. Home Depot's product specifications make it easy to choose a fan that fits both the physical dimensions and the intended use of the room.
Energy Efficiency and Smart Features
Modern Home Depot fan lights are engineered with energy efficiency in mind. The use of DC motor technology is becoming increasingly common, as these motors consume a fraction of the energy used by traditional AC motors while delivering strong performance. Many models are ENERGY STAR® certified, guaranteeing they meet strict efficiency guidelines. Furthermore, the integration of smart technology is a growing trend. Smart fans can be controlled via smartphone apps, allowing users to adjust settings remotely, schedule operation, and even monitor energy usage. Some models are compatible with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ant, enabling hands-free control for ultimate convenience.

Installation and Maintenance Tips
While some homeowners may opt for professional installation, many Home Depot fan lights are designed for DIY installation with clear, step-by-step instructions. The process typically involves securing the mounting bracket to an electrical box, assembling the fan components, and wiring the fixture to the home's electrical system. It is essential to ensure the electrical box is rated to support the weight of the fan. Regular maintenance is straightforward: dusting the blades and fixture periodically with a soft cloth keeps the unit looking clean and operating efficiently. Checking the tension of the blades and ensuring all screws are tight can prevent wobble and extend the life of the fan.
Making the Right Purchase Decision
When shopping for a fan light at Home Depot, comparing options based on specific needs is key. Consider factors such as the room's size, your climate, and desired energy savings. Look for detailed product descriptions that outline the fan's airflow capacity, meas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), and its Noise-Cancellation rating (sone level). A higher CFM rating indicates better air-moving ability, while a lower sone rating signifies quieter operation. Warranty information is also an important detail, as it reflects the manufacturer's confidence in the product's durability and can provide peace of mind for your investment.
